BRAXTON DENNY DUCHARME It is with heavy hearts that we announce the passing of Braxton Denny Ducharme, who was tragically taken from us at the young age of 19, on Friday, May 27, 2016. Left behind to cherish Braxton's memories are his parents Dennis Ducharme and Jackie Hill; his big sister Brittany Ducharme; best friend Josh Lourenco; beloved girlfriend Hannah Lester; his paternal grandparents Norman and Vicki Ducharme; maternal grannie Doreen Hill; along with many aunts, uncles, cousins, and numerous friends and family. He was predeceased by his grandpa, Robert Hill, and his great-grandparents Phyllis and Deny Clare, Harvey and Bernice Ducharme, William and Maja Oliver and Thomas and Rose Hill. In the four years that Braxton attended Tec Voc High School, he grew a burning passion for football. His dedication lead him to success on and off the field. After graduation Braxton found a job with a great group of guys at VIDA Insulation and strived to successfully climb the ranks of the trade. Braxton was a man with a drive to achieve the highest level of anything he ever tried, whether it be football, cheerleading, or weightlifting; he gave his all and accomplished everything he set out to do. Braxton also had a great love for the outdoors. Some of his best times were spent deer hunting, duck hunting, fishing, camping, and 4x4-ing with friends. He will be remembered for his amazing personality, dedication, hard work, and infectious smile. On Saturday, June 4, 2016, Braxton's Funeral Service will be held at 1:00 p.m. in the Woodlands Community Hall, 204 Argyle Street, Woodlands, MB. Interment will follow in Woodlands (St. George's) Cemetery, Woodlands. In lieu of flowers, donations can be made to the Tec Voc High School Football Program, 1555 Wall Street, Winnipeg, MB R3E 2S2.
